$ With the patches, some more irq problems occur. ("pci_intr_map: no
$ mapping for pin...") This is the same with the first and the second set
$ of patches.

If possible,Would you please try to disable PCI_INTR_FIXUP?
When enabling acpi,ACPI_PCI_FIXUP may fixup IRQ routing.
